

The rum is aged using the solera process for aging spirits, in which barrels containing older spirits are “topped off” and married with younger spirit from other barrels as the angel’s share takes its toll. Afterwards the rums blended are aged again in Single Malt Scotch Whisky oak barrels for at least 6 months. By the time, the rum is bottled.
TASTING NOTES:
NOSE: Clean aroma of oak-aged runoff, aromatic notes of roasted malt, proper balance between components, aromatic cane and malted barley, very well aged.
PALATE: Slightly sweet malt taste, balanced and smooth, stays honest, well-evolved, taste of well-transformed wood and well-integrated with the roasted malt, and cane eaux-de-vie. Noticeable taste of vanilla, sweet almonds, and raisins.
